industry and whether it’s really worth your money to invest in a shoe like this so these SP of shoes are supposed to be lighter than the C4 and the H4 models from the previous two years is so what Echo have done is they’ve used their existing fluid fo and then this new new technology of lighter fo which still gives you that high level rebound cushioning and stability under the shoe but it’s just a little bit lighter to make the overall shoe in your hands and on your feet you know just just give you that bit more longevity out on the golf course so that foam is then combined underneath the shoe and you can see here in the in the out soole and and in the little the main shank in the middle of the shoe here to create an edts net design now in English DTS stands for dynamic traction system so basically that’s just saying that this here the outsole of the shoe if you take a look there’s different size kind of lugs some of them have different firmness um some are harder than others and they’re all kind of facing different ways specifically designed to give you the most traction on the golf course regardless of of of where you’re playing them what sort of surface you’re playing them and then finally you’d probably look at these and think they’re a summer shoe but actually they are waterproof as well so they’ve got a waterproof membrane coating over the upper of the shoe and all around here to really give you that waterproof security for playing in all different types of conditions as well you’ll have seen the bow system on these now they do come available in lace but I’ve got them in the bower lacing system as well and I’ll talk a little bit about that in just a second now the price of the echo LT1 as we’ve kind of come to expect with Echo and the way they position themselves in the market the premium shoes they use premium materials we’ve kind of seen that over the years so it’s no shock to be fair that the lace version of these the kind of Standard Version if you like is 170 RRP now the bower these I’ve got in front of me are at200 now for a spikeless shoe I think that’s a lot of money but as I said we know that about Echo I just think that there’s some other models in the industry and in the market that might give you a little bit of value for money but we’ll come to that in a second once we’ve looked at the performance on the golf bit bit of a tough one to clean okay so like all of our golf shoe reviews we tested these on the golf course and as you know in the UK it’s been wet it’s been damp but we picked a fairly bright Spring Light day now straight away putting them on you get that Echo feel you get that fit that hugs your foot that you get that mesh inside the shoe that really like I say hugs your foot and gives you that really comfortable satisfying feeling as you’re putting the shoes on you always get that from echo shoes and nothing changes here super comfortable straight out of the box and then as I started to walk in these Go shoes hit golf shots you know walk up hills walk downhills and just really wear these shoes in a little bit yeah that continued what I really liked and something I want to mention is this kind of inside the tongue area I’m not quite sure if you can see that there but there’s there’s almost like a inside sock liner that attaches from the sides of the shoe to the tongue itself and you get this kind of really stretchy material there and that sits on the top of the shoe really nice cuz sometimes I find with Bower that if it’s wrapped quite tightly the thin lacing of the bower can be a little bit harsh on the bridge of on your Bridge of your foot but whereas something like this that kind of mesh really nice soft cushion in there can combat that really nicely so there’s no kind of little aches when you first put these on and you’ve got them tied tightly with with the bow at all really really comfy on the top of the shoe underneath you get an oror light insole so I’m just going to pull this out because actually what it says on the sole itself this is quite a thin insole it says there I don’t know if you can see that but it says remove for extra width so you get this really thin orite insole and then there’s another one below which is a little bit firmer but it then says there in the shoe extra WID I did do a little bit of testing with the insult out of the shoe you still get a really really comforting feel underneath your foot even with that insult not in now moving on to the traction of the shoes as I say on test it was a fairly wet kind of wintry day I was pretty impressed I had no issues whatsoever playing out the sand hitting drivers hitting irons hitting from different lies although there’s not much to this shoe that doesn’t look to be in terms of the design of the actual outsole I was pretty confident on the golf course the only thing I would say if it was raining if it was really wet if I was playing on almost a damp lynxy course where there’s not as much kind of grab to the turf would I be 100% confident in wearing these if I was playing in kind of a medal or a singles competition I think I would probably go for something that had a little bit more grab to them on the bottom of the shoe whether that’s Spike shoes or just a spikeless you maybe the pro SLX just gives you that little bit more but you’ll have to let me know on that as I say when I did my testing pretty good but wasn’t 100% comfortable if it did get really wet okay so after testing these over 18 holes and comparing them to some other shoes what is my verdict of the echo LT1 they’re a great golf shoe I think once you go Echo you kind of never go back I think there’s always somebody at your Golf Club there’s always somebody in a four ball who swears by Echo and I think those guys will love this shoe it does exactly what echo shoes want to do it’s premium materials it’s comfortable it’s got decent traction it’s got you know it’s breathable it looks pretty good it looks exactly like an echo shoe should but for me I think there’s better value for money in the spikeless shoe out there and there’s another thing that I kind of just want to flag that I was a little bit disappointed with having tested the shoes and then taking a closer look at them after giving them a bit of a clean after the round so if you take a closer look here now I’ve only played in these for 18 holes and you can see here on this section of the shoe where you see the kind of upper you’ve got this first piece of foam second piece of foam and then the out soole on this second bit here you can just see some marking there now I have scrubbed that pretty hard to try to get that off you can see it there on the front of the shoe on the toe you can see it a little bit there and you can also see it a little bit here and a little bit on the back of the shoe there I was just a little bit disappointed at how easy that section of the shoe marked up over one round of golf if you were end to look at that after 10 Rounds 20 rounds a season playing in the UK what’s that what’s that going to look like I’m not quite sure so a little bit disappointed about that I have to say but all in all ekko’s claims about creating a lighter shoe than their predecessors that we’ve seen in the H4 and the C4 in previous years this is light it’s light to hold I enjoyed wearing it on the golf course and after 18 holes you know my feet didn’t feel tired it were really lightweight to wear so if that’s the kind of shoe you’re after for this year could be a great option for you now my final thoughts have to come back to the value for money for these shoes as I say £00 for Boer 170 for Lac I just think you look at the Adidas s2g at 90 yes probably not going to last as long probably not using as many premium materials you then look at the Puma GSX effect 100 similar [ __ ] the shoe great traction yes maybe not as many premium materials yes you don’t get the bower but you’re looking at nearly £100 difference there and if I was spending my own money would I go for a shoe like this probably not so that’s my review of the echo LT1 shoes thank you so much for watching get down into those
